- <init>
Constructor used for testing. Allows disabling of the eviction thread.
- acceptableSize
- cacheBlock
Cache the block with the specified name and buffer. It is assumed this will
NEVER be called on an al
- evictBlocksByHfileName
Evicts all blocks for a specific HFile. This is an expensive operation
implemented as a linear-time
- getBlock
- getBlockCount
- getCurrentSize
Get the current size of this cache.
- getMaxSize
Get the maximum size of this cache.
- heapSize
- calculateOverhead
- evict
Eviction method.
- evictBlock